Shankar Rao describes CM as "weak captain"


Hyderabad, Aug 14 : Former minister Dr P Shankar Rao on Tuesday referred to Chief Minister N Kiran Kumar as a bad 'captain' whose team members are falling apart, one by one.

Talking to reporters in the Legislative Assembly premises, Dr Shankar Rao said that the Chief Minister was proving to be a very bad captain. "One wicket was already down and another has just fallen," he said while referring to the arrest of former Excise Minister Mopidevi Venkataramana and and now the naming of Roads and Buildings Minister B Dharmana Prasad Rao as the accused in Kadapa MP Jaganmohan Reddy's assets case.

Dr Shankar Rao alleged that the Chief Minister was shielding the corrupt ministers. He said that the ministers who have been served notices by the Supreme Court in connection with 26 controversial GOs that allegedly favoured Jaganmohan Reddy amass illegal wealth should resign from the cabinet. Else, he demanded that the Chief Minister dismiss them from the cabinet.

He said that sheilding tainted minister would spoil the image of the Congress party and the Government.  He said no one would be ready to contest on the Congress ticket during the next elections, if immediate measures were not taken to save party's image. He said he would soon brief Congress president Sonia Gandhi and Rahul Gandhi about the real situation prevailing in the State and would demand total reshuffled of State cabinet.
